Understanding Blind Flanges The Unsung Heroes of Piping Systems
In the world of piping systems, various fittings and components play crucial roles in ensuring the integrity and functionality of the entire structure. Among these components, blind flanges stand out as essential, yet often overlooked, elements that contribute significantly to the efficiency of pipe systems. In this article, we will explore what blind flanges are, their applications, benefits, and the factors to consider when choosing them for your piping projects.
What is a Blind Flange?
A blind flange is a type of flange that is used to seal the end of a piping system or to close a vessel opening. Unlike other flanges that connect two sections of pipe or fittings, blind flanges do not have a central hole. Instead, they serve as a solid cover, providing a strong seal that prevents leakage of fluids and gases. Blind flanges are typically made from various materials, including carbon steel, stainless steel, and alloys, making them suitable for diverse applications and environments.
Applications of Blind Flanges
Blind flanges are utilized in a variety of industries, including oil and gas, water treatment, chemical processing, and power generation. They are commonly used in the following situations
1. Sealing Open Ends When a pipe line needs to be temporarily or permanently closed, blind flanges provide an effective solution. This is particularly useful during maintenance or in systems where future expansion is anticipated.
2. Pressure Testing Blind flanges allow for pressure testing of piping systems. By sealing the ends of pipes, technicians can test the system for leaks without needing to disconnect or disassemble the piping.
3. Blockage of Flow In systems where flow needs to be stopped completely, blind flanges provide a reliable barrier, ensuring that no fluid or gas escapes.
4. Vessel Closure In pressure vessels and industrial containers, blind flanges are often used to seal openings, contributing to the overall safety and functionality of the system.
Benefits of Using Blind Flanges
Blind flanges offer several advantages that make them a preferred choice in many applications
1. Leak Prevention The main benefit of using blind flanges is their ability to prevent leaks. By providing a robust seal, they minimize the risk of fluid loss, which can lead to costly environmental hazards and operational disruptions.
2. Versatility Available in various sizes and materials, blind flanges can be used in a wide range of applications. Whether in a high-pressure steam line or a chemical process, there is a blind flange suitable for the job.
3. Cost-Effectiveness By allowing for maintenance and inspection without requiring extensive disassembly of a system, blind flanges can reduce labor costs and downtime, making them a cost-effective option.
4. Ease of Installation Installing blind flanges is relatively straightforward, requiring standard tools and techniques. This ease of installation helps streamline construction and maintenance processes.
Selecting the Right Blind Flange
When choosing a blind flange, several factors must be considered
1. Material The material should be compatible with the fluid or gas being contained, considering factors such as temperature, pressure, and corrosiveness.
2. Size and Rating Determining the appropriate size and pressure rating is vital for ensuring the flange can handle the operational conditions of the piping system.
3. Standards and Certifications Ensure that the blind flanges comply with relevant industry standards and certifications to guarantee quality and safety.
4. End Connection Type It's essential to select a flange that matches the end connection type (e.g., welded, threaded) of the piping system to ensure a proper fit.
